INSTRUCTIONS
Pursuant to 20 AAC 25.070, attach to this form: well schematic diagram, summary of daily well operations, directional or inclination survey, and
other tests as required including, but not limited to: core analysis, paleontological report, production or well test results.
Report measured depth and true vertical thickness of permafrost. Provide MD and TVD for the top and base of permafrost in Box 29.
Attached supplemental records should show the details of any multiple stage cementing and the location of the cementing tool.
If this well is completed for separate production from more than one interval (multiple completion), so state in item 1, and in item 23 show the
producing intervals for only the interval reported in item 26. (Submit a separate form for each additional interval to be separately produced,
showing the data pertinent to such interval).
Provide a listing of intervals cored and the corresponding formations, and a brief description in this box. Pursuant to 20 AAC 25.071, submit
detailed descriptions, core chips, photographs, and all subsequent laboratory analytical results, including, but not limited to: porosity,
permeability, fluid saturation, fluid composition, fluid fluorescence, vitrinite reflectance, geochemical, or paleontology.
Method of Operation: Flowing, Gas Lift, Rod Pump, Hydraulic Pump, Submersible, Water Injection, Gas Injection, Shut-in, or Other (explain).
Provide a listing of intervals tested and the corresponding formation, and a brief summary in this box. Submit detailed test and analytical
laboratory information required by 20 AAC 25.071.
Review the reporting requirements of 20 AAC 25.071 and, pursuant to AS 31.05.030, submit all electronic data within 90 days of completion,
suspension, or abandonment; or 90 days after log acquisition, whichever occurs first.
Well Class - Service wells: Gas Injection, Water Injection, Water-Alternating-Gas Injection, Salt Water Disposal, Water Supply for Injection,
Observation, or Other.
Kuparuk A4
Kuparuk A5
Authorized Title:
Report the Division of Oil & Gas / Division of Mining Land and Water: Plan of Operations (LO/Region YY-123), Land Use Permit (LAS 12345),
and/or Easement (ADL 123456) number.
The Kelly Bushing, Ground Level, and Base Flange elevations in feet above Mean Sea Level. Use same as reference for depth measurements
given in other spaces on this form and in any attachments.
The API number reported to AOGCC must be 14 digits (ex: 50-029-20123-00-00).
This form and the required attachments provide a complete and concise record for each well drilled in Alaska. Submit a current well schematic
diagram with each 10-407. Submit 10-407 and attachments in PDF format to aogcc.permitting@alaska.gov. All laboratory analytical reports from
a well must be submitted to the AOGCC, no matter when the analyses are conducted per 20 AAC 25.071.
Information to be attached includes, but is not limited to: summary of daily operations, wellbore schematic, directional or inclination survey, as-built, core
analysis, paleontological report, production or well test results, per 20 AAC 25.070.
Multiple completion is defined as a well producing from more than one pool with production from each pool completely segregated. Each
segregated pool is a completion.

DTTMSTART JOBTYP SUMMARYOPS
12/19/2022 DRILLING
SIDETRACK
Complete RD on 2G-09. Move rig from 2G pad toward 1E pad.
12/20/2022 DRILLING
SIDETRACK
Continue to move to 1E pad. Spot sub and servce modules oe 1E-21. RU CDR3-
AC. Rig accepted @ 10:00am on 12/20/22, Test bop's AOGCC Witnessed by Brian
Bixby 250/4000, test tiger tank and pdl's, pick up BHA# 1 HEW
12/21/2022 DRILLING
SIDETRACK
Finish deploying BHA# 1 HEW, RIH w/ HEW flushing well with seawater, tie in -12'
correction, Set HEW on depth 7100' TOWS, displace well to millng fluid , pooh
deploy BHA# 2 milling BHA, RIH tie in -13' correction, tag ws pinch point @ 7105' ,
start milling F/ 7104.8 to midnight depth of 7106.1'
12/22/2022 DRILLING
SIDETRACK
Complete 2.80" exit, ream window per plan and dry drift clean, TD rat hole @ 7122',
POOH for Build assembly 2.4° AKO targeting 45° dls, Flush stack and deploy BHA#
3 RIH tie in -14 correction, pass through window clean, Drill build F/ 7122' T/ 7432'
average DLS 47°, POOH for ER Lateral Assembly
12/23/2022 DRILLING
SIDETRACK
Un-deploy build BHA, Deploy BHA# 4 ER lateral assembly, RIH and drill ahead with
.5° AKO w/ nov agitator and HYC A3 bit, drill to depth of 8697, start scheduled wiper
trip
12/24/2022 DRILLING
SIDETRACK
Continue drilling ahead performing wipers when nesessary, 9300' out of zone pump
sweeps pooh for OHAB
12/25/2022 DRILLING
SIDETRACK
Continued out of the hole for OHAB, un-deployed BHA# 4 Lateral assembly,
Deployed BHA# 5 OHAB ran in hole tied in for -14, Set TOB 8025', pooh for ER
Lateral Assembly, Deploy BHA# 6 ER Lateral Assembly .6° AKO w/ NOV agitator
and HYC A3 bit, RIH tie in -13' correction, Dry tag billet @ 7826', mill off billet per
best practice and drill ahead performing wipers as needed, new mud at bit 8077'
12/26/2022 DRILLING
SIDETRACK
Drill ahead from 8,349' to midnight depth of 9585 wiping the hole and tying in per
recomended practice.
12/27/2022 DRILLING
SIDETRACK
Drill ahead 9585 to corrected TD 9802' Perform swab wiper trip. On bottom waiting
for liner running pill downhole tool failure. Trip for replacement BHA. PUD BHA #6.
Perform BOPE functiob test - Good. PD BHA #7
12/28/2022 DRILLING
SIDETRACK
Trip in BHA #7, Tie in for -14'. Clean trip to bottom 9802'. POOH pumping beaded
liner running pill to window. 13.3PPg KWF to surface. Flow check well. Lay down
BHA #7. M/U lower liner segment, Non ported nose, 40 Jts liner, NSQC receptical.
Trip in. Correct -17' at pipe flag. Clean pass through window. Set down @ 8308'.
Work pipe. Unable to move liner up or down. Release liner. TOL=7050'. POOH for
fishing tool string. Make up BHA #9 fish liner with Jars. Trip in. Tie in for -14'. Latch
fish @ 7048. Start Jarring up
12/29/2022 DRILLING
SIDETRACK
Continue jarring on stuck liner. Unable to get liner moving. Release from liner. Trip
out for second liner run. Put Sealbore deployment sleeve @ 7010'. Get BHP 4237
PSI, @ sensor depth 6093.54 TVD. Check tree bolts. Trip out. Freeze protect tubing
from 2500' with diesel
12/30/2022 DRILLING
SIDETRACK
Blow down reel with N2, rig up and un-stab coil secure for reel swap , change rams
in doors and Nipple down Rig released 06:00 on 12/30/22

Enclosed is the approved application for the permit to drill the above referenced well.
The permit is for a new wellbore segment of existing well Permit Number 183-002, API Number 50-029-
20892-00-00. Production from or injection into this wellbore must be reported under the original API
Number stated above.
Per Statute AS 31.05.030(d)(2)(B) and Regulation 20 AAC 25.071, composite curves for all well logs run
must be submitted to the AOGCC within 90 days after completion, suspension, or abandonment of this
well, or within 90 days of acquisition of the data, whichever occurs first.
This permit to drill does not exempt you from obtaining additional permits or an approval required by law
from other governmental agencies and does not authorize conducting drilling operations until all other
required permits and approvals have been issued. In addition, the AOGCC reserves the right to withdraw
the permit in the event it was erroneously issued.
Operations must be conducted in accordance with AS 31.05 and Title 20, Chapter 25 of the Alaska
Administrative Code unless the AOGCC specifically authorizes a variance. Failure to comply with an
applicable provision of AS 31.05, Title 20, Chapter 25 of the Alaska Administrative Code, or an AOGCC
order, or the terms and conditions of this permit may result in the revocation or suspension of the permit.
